As to some of your questions:
-If you're in the military, take a look at Shades of Green... see whether you can stay there and what the rates are.
- Otherwise, I'm guessing you want one of the Value resorts.

Either way you'll want to book ASAP.

I'm a big fan of the parkhoppers. I think they're well worth the money in terms of the flexibility they give you. On the other hand, I'm not spending the money on the waterparks (and I'm going in August.) The resort pools are fine. And who know how the weather will be when you go. (A friend of mine went for New Years 2008-- some days were pleasant, but some were COLD!)
 
Hi there! We went this past year from Nov. 30th to Dec. 6th and had a fabulous time. A couple of chilly nights, some swimmable days, and beautiful Xmas decorations! I would definitely go during that timeframe again next time. It was perfect.
 
I think thats a GREAT time of year to go! I've heard its pretty low crowds inbetween Thanksgiving and Christmas .. and from living in FL for a few years the weather is great that time of year. Like the PP said, probubly a few cool nights but also a few days that will be swimable.

I also agree, book ASAP if that is when you want to go. I think the park hopper is great, plus it's only $25 to upgrade the military tickets so they are park hoppers (I think anyway, we are upgrading but forget the exact price) DEF worth an extra $25 per person ...
